Assessing Legal Professional Charges: What You Must to Recognize

How can people ensure they are making informed decisions when evaluating attorney fees? Comprehending the fee structure is essential. Attorneys may charge hourly rates, flat fees, or retained fees, each with distinct implications for the total cost. Individuals should ask about what services are included in the fee and whether addit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, matching information may arise.

Assessing fees from many attorneys is vital, but the lowest price may not always indicate the finest quality. It's crucial to examine the attorney's proficiency, track record, and achievement rate in tandem with their rates. Additionally, individuals should ask about payment arrangements or financing options to relieve fiscal stress. Openness is important; a respected attorney will present a detailed accounting of expenditures and answer questions without hesitation. Ultimately, educated choices stem from thorough research and open communication regarding fees and services provided.

Frequently Requested Questions

How long does the procedure usually take?

The immigration process typically require several months through several years, contingent upon multiple considerations including the application type, country of residence, and present processing times at immigration departments.

What Perils Come from Tackling Immigration Issues Lacking an Attorney?

Handling immigration issues without an lawyer can result in misunderstandings, delays, and possible denials. Individuals may miss important deadlines, overlook necessary documentation, or misunderstand legal requirements, ultimately compromising their chances of obtaining favorable results.

Can I Switch Migrant Lawyers During My Case?

Yes, people can switch immigration lawyers during a case. However, it's critical to assess potential setbacks and postponements in the process. Proper communication and documentation are necessary to ensure a efficient transition between legal representatives.

What should I take action if My Request Is Denied?

Should an application be denied, the individual should carefully review the rejection correspondence, recognize the causes of rejection, compile essential documents, and consider reapplying or appealing the decision within the specified timeframe to boost likelihood of favorable outcome.

What Can I Do to Prepare for My Attorney's Discussion?

To get ready for a lawyer's consultation, an individual should assemble relevant documents, outline important questions, and record important details about their case. This groundwork enhances communication and ensures a productive conversation about immigration matters.
